December 7, 2018 Opinion or Order TEXT ORDER entered by Judge Colin Stirling Bruce on 12/7/18. On October 23, 2018, the Court noted that Plaintiff had neither paid the required filing fee nor moved for leave to proceed in forma pauperis in this case. The Court gave Plaintiff twenty-one days from the date of that Order to take one of these actions. On November 2, 2018, the Court denied Plaintiff's request to amend his Complaint but gave him leave to try again. In its Order, the Court informed Plaintiff what he must do if he wanted to amend his Complaint, and the Court provided forms to Plaintiff that he could use to amend his Complaint and that he could use to move for leave to proceed in forma pauperis if he could not pay the required filing fee in full. The Court warned Plaintiff that this case could be dismissed if he did not comply with the Court's Orders. Since the Court entered its two Orders, Plaintiff has written letters to the Court, but he has not complied with the Court's Orders. Plaintiff was not required to amend his Complaint or to use the forms provided by the Court, but he was required either to pay the filing fee or move for leave to proceed in forma pauperis. Plaintiff has done neither within the timeframe provided by the Court. Accordingly, this case is DISMISSED WITHOUT PREJUDICE based upon Plaintiff's failure to pay the required filing fee. All pending motions are moot. This case is CLOSED. No judgment to enter. (Civil Case Terminated.) (KM, ilcd)
November 27, 2018 Opinion or Order TEXT ORDER entered by Judge Harold A. Baker on 11/27/2018. Plaintiff's motion for counsel #8 is DENIED with leave to renew upon demonstrating that he has made attempts to hire his own counsel. Pruitt v. Mote, 503 F.3d 647, 654-55 (7th Cir. 2007). This showing typically requires writing to several lawyers and attaching their responses. If Plaintiff renews his motion, he should set forth how far he has gone in school, any jobs he has held inside and outside of prison, any classes he has taken in prison, and any prior litigation experience he has. Finally, the Court will not typically attempt to recruit counsel until Plaintiff can demonstrate or has demonstrated that he has or can state a claim upon which relief can be granted at a merit review of his Complaint. November 2, 2018 Opinion or Order TEXT ORDER entered by Judge Harold A. Baker on 11/2/2018. Plaintiff's motion for leave to file an amended complaint #5 is DENIED. The Court does not accept piecemeal amendments to pleadings. If Plaintiff desires to amend his Complaint to add a Defendant, to add a claim, or to substitute a Defendant, he should file a motion seeking leave to do so in which he identifies the changes that he desires to make in his Complaint. In addition, Plaintiff should attach a complete, proposed amended complaint that, if granted leave to file, will completely replace his original Complaint and will stand on its own without reference to or reliance upon his Original Complaint. Flannery v. Recording Indus. Ass'n of Am., 354 F.3d 632, 638 n.1 (7th Cir. 2004). The proposed Amended Complaint should explain what Defendants did or did not do, including the proposed new Defendant(s), and why their actions or inactions violated Plaintiff's constitutional rights. The Clerk of the Court is directed to send the forms necessary to file a section 1983 case to Plaintiff. The Court strongly encourages Plaintiff to use these forms to file an amended complaint. Once the Court receives Plaintiff's proposed amended complaint, the Court will conduct a merit review of that proposed amended complaint that is required by 28 U.S.C. Section 1915A. Plaintiff should file his proposed amended complaint within thirty (30) days from the date of this Order, or the Court may dismiss this case. (Amended Pleadings due by 12/3/2018.) (KE, ilcd)

October 23, 2018 Opinion or Order TEXT ORDER Entered by Magistrate Judge Eric I. Long on 10/23/18. Plaintiff has filed a Complaint but has not paid the $400 filing fee nor filed a petition to proceed in forma pauperis. Within 21 days of the entry of this order, Plaintiff must pay the $400 filing fee in full or file a petition to proceed in forma pauperis with attached trust fund ledgers for the last 6 months. Failure to comply without good cause will result in dismissal of this case without prejudice, and the Plaintiff will still be responsible for payment of the filing fee. See 28 U.S.C. Sec. 1914. The Clerk is directed to send Plaintiff the forms for proceeding in forma pauperis. ( Miscellaneous Deadline 11/13/2018)(SKR, ilcd)
